HALL OF FAME INDUCTEE
PHILO T. FARNSWORTH

Inventor of TELEVISION
Bio:
Television was conceived by several visionaries and even science fiction writers before it ever existed. It took an inventor like Farnsworth to make it a reality. His self-taught knowledge and creativity figured out how to put the electron to work to provide recognizable images electronically. Although he never received his rightful monetary or scientific recognition, it was his invention that changed the world, for better or worse.
